المستخلص: Humanity communities suffer from worsening manifestations of intolerance and violence stemming from class struggle and social waves; the latest imbalance in the system of values and fundamentals governing the relationship with the other and living with so much so remove him intellectually, politically, religiously, and rule mentality of prohibition and criminalization, so the world today needs an effective and positive coexistence and tolerance more than ever; hence the concept of tolerance had a great attention by philosophers and thinkers on the basis that it works on the cohesion of societies and balance, as well as being helpful The widespread understanding and collaboration between community members, so they can sustain life and achieve their goals and objectives. The concept of tolerance is one of the contemporary humanity concepts, which accompanied the great transformations in the world now and the winds of globalization had moved to our Arabic countries, so we should root it in Arabic region suitably and give it an opportunity to reflect on the reality and respond to its needs and problems, this will be achieved only through educational institutions, including universities, which bears the responsibility for providing programs and curricula promote the values of tolerance and peaceful coexistence among graduates who in turn Live models to move these values across successive generations, from Al Azhar University is the most important These universities if not the most important because it mandated posting moderation and renewal of religious discourse, beyond its impact within the region Egypt Arabic at home and perhaps to many parts of the world as well as its role in community service and leadership role in carrying the banner of religious knowledge and call Allah gently and Lynn. Problem of the study: Egyptian society is suffering today from all kinds of conflict (intellectual, cultural and stratification) at all levels, leading to further social disintegration and a culture of hate and bickering among members of society, then the spread of chaos and violence, injustice and restrict freedoms, which shows that Egyptian society is suffering a real crisis in the absence of a culture of tolerance; and then there was an urgent need to find a positive value system, finding a psychic combination based on tolerance, for this to happen we must work to promote a culture of compassionate community, This is confirmed by many previous studies, prompting educators and behavior to emphasize the values and cultures which call for unity, renounced the band and especially the culture of tolerance through various educational institutions especially universities and the most important of these universities "Al-Azhar University", hence the importance of this study to address this topic from an educational standpoint because of its necessity in this historic conflict-filled recently and incidents of violence, revolutions, and the other for standing on the proposed role of Al-Azhar University in disseminating a culture of tolerance. Study questions The current study attempted to answer the question:

1. what are the intellectual and philosophical origins of the culture of tolerance? 2. what role can be played by Al-Azhar University in disseminating a culture of tolerance? 3. To what extent respondents views differ about the degree of importance of the proposed roles of Al-Azhar University in disseminating a culture of tolerance according to variables (type, specialty, degree, and location of PhD). 4. What is proposed perception for the development of the role of Al-Azhar University in disseminating a culture of tolerance? Objectives of the study: The current study aimed to identify the expected role of Al-Azhar University in disseminating a culture of tolerance through the following objectives:- - Analyzing what tolerance is, its philosophy, its aims and its principles. - Determine the reasons for interest in the culture of tolerance in our modern world. - Identify the aspects of the role of Al-Azhar University in disseminating a culture of tolerance (management, faculty, curriculum and activities). - Designing a proposed perception for the development of the role of Al-Azhar University in the dissemination of a culture of tolerance in the light of the outcome of the field study. Methodology of the study and its methods: The study used the descriptive analytical method to reach its goals, and adopted the questionnaire as a tool for information gathering, where a sample strength (400) as a member of the faculty at Al-Azhar University, for their view on how important the resolution from the proposed roles for the University that can contribute to a culture of tolerance. The most important results of the study: 1. the study in its entirety to the great importance of all proposed roles through four hubs, with approval of the proposed roles in the overall resolution 92, 09. 2. the results of the study indicated that the response of the sample on the first axis of the importance role of University Administration (leadership) in a culture of tolerance in agreeing very much, with the relative weights of those phrases (1-16) between (4, 2575) and (4, 7975), the average response of respondents on the axis as a whole (4, 58). 3. the results of the study indicated that the response of the sample on the importance of the second pillar as a faculty member in a culture of tolerance in agreeing very much, with the relative weights of those phrases (17-33) between (4, 4375) and (4, 7475), the average response of respondents on the axis as a whole (4,626). 4. the results of the study indicated that the response of the sample on the importance of the third axis on the role of curriculum and syllabus in culture of tolerance in agreeing very much, with the relative weights of those phrases (34-45) between (4, 49, 4, 6775), the average response of respondents on the axis as a whole (4,579). 5. the results of the study indicated that the response of the sample on the importance of the fourth axis on the role of student activities in the dissemination of a culture of tolerance in agreeing very much, with the relative weights of those phrases (46-62) between (4, 46, 4, 7125), the average response of respondents on the axis as a whole (4,624). Recommendations of the study: The study found proposed visualization included a series of roles that Al- Azhar University to contribute to the dissemination of a culture of tolerance, with reference to some mechanisms by which to activate those roles.
